Total Wireless vs. Verizon Wireless – Is cheaper better?

When placed side by side, Total Wireless and Verizon Wireless present many dissimilar characteristics, and this is because they are meant for different uses. So, which one makes a better match, and why?

When it comes to wireless communication from mobile carriers, you will notice that there are two main extremes. There are mobile carriers that offer tailor made plans for individuals and families, and they are able to remain pretty cheap, and this is where Total Wireless falls. On the other hand, there are mobile carriers like Verizon Wireless that come with plans whose main offers comprise of unlimited talk time and even data, but they remain quite expensive.

When to use Total Wireless

Known for providing multiple plans to both individuals and families alike, Total Wireless makes an ideal match for people who have high data needs, but who are also on a budget. It is a highly reliable mobile carrier that promises great coverage wherever you are, and it comes with a good deal of perks. Seeing as it offers bundles that come with unlimited data for a significantly lower price, it stands out as one of the best options when you want to save a good deal of money.

When to use Verizon Wireless

Easily one of the largest and most reliable mobile carriers in the United States, Verizon Wireless makes an incredible match for people who are looking for high end services that include unlimited data on 5G speed, incredible coverage no matter where you are, and loads of perks such as subscriptions to TV channels that are considered premium. In the same breath, it is not considered ideal for people who want to save a con here and there since it is more expensive than most other mobile carriers.

Total Wireless Review

Known for its incredible and inclusive packages, Total Wireless has proven to be one f the most elaborate yet affordable mobile carriers around. It has great packages to choose from for both individuals and families, and they are pretty cheap. One of the main reasons behind this is the fact that it does not have its own network towers and, therefore, relies on major mobile carriers to transmit coverage.

This means that it is an MVNO, and the fact that it does not have its own towers eliminates maintenance costs, allowing for cheaper bundles for all users. To make sure that the larger populace can gain access to, Total Wireless provides a total of 6 plans that cover both individual and family users. The plans are laid out as below.

 It is worth noting that the subscription costs indicated above are inclusive of refill, and it would cost you a dollar more on each if you paid without it.

When it comes to the data provided, you will be able to enjoy 4G speeds so long as the provided limit is not exceeded. In case you surpass it, the internet speeds drop from 4G to 2G, making it hard to stream content. In addition, you will experience data deprioritization which causes your speeds to drop during peak hours of use and when you are in highly populated areas.

 Verizon Wireless Review

Verizon Wireless is one of the largest and most efficient mobile carriers in the country currently, and it is known best for its incredible 5G speeds that place it ahead of its competition which includes AT&T, T-Mobile and Sprint. If you are looking for unlimited data plans that come with a wholelot of perks, this is the network for you, but have in mind that it does not come cheap.

Unlike Total Wireless, Verizon Wireless has its own network towers spread throughout the country, and this is largely why it comes with great coverage and incredible speeds. Aside from high internet speeds, Verizon Wireless also come with more than 25 plans from which to choose, and they are comprised of both individual and family bundles. We have captured a few below.

 Total Wireless vs. Verizon Wireless – How do they compare?

Number of available plans

With Total Wireless, you are going to have a total of 6 plans from which to choose, and they include both individual and family plans. Verizon Wireless, on the other hand, comes with more than 25 plans that include both individual and family bundles, making it better than Total Wireless.  

Data Prices

Total Wireless seems to take the lead when it comes to cheaper bundle prices, but you will notice that you actually get a whole lot less for your money.

Even though Verizon Wireless is notably more expensive with unlimited plans that cost upwards of $80, you will enjoy much faster speeds and unlimited data, and this makes it better than Verizon Wireless.

 Mobile Hotspot

Total Wireless provides just 10GB of LTE hotspot, and even this is not available on all its plans. Verizon Wireless, on the other hand, comes with hotpot for a good majority of plans, with the lowest starting at 15GB. This makes it better than Total Wireless.  

Conclusion

Even though Total Wireless is clearly the cheaper option of the two, we cannot fail to acknowledge that Verizon Wireless comes with much better plans and features for users such as unlimited data, great speeds and even excellent coverage. For this reason, it makes a better option than Total Wireless.
